Tottenham Hotspur star Oliver Skipp suspended for the clash against Leeds United

According to Football.London, Tottenham Hotspur midfielder Oliver Skipp will miss the match against Leeds United in the Premier League after he racked up five yellow cards. He picked up the latest one in the draw against Everton at Goodison Park.

Antonio Conte will face yet another obstacle as he will be missing the services of the 21-year-old in the next game. He has started the midfielder in his first two games as the Spurs manager and has been consistent in both these games.

Skipp picked up the yellow card in the 92-minute after he had stopped a dangerous counter from the Toffees. It will be a big blow, as he had been solid throughout this season and has continued that under the new boss.

Oliver Skipp has been crucial this season. 

While nothing spectacular, the England international helped multiple times to ensure stability was achieved in midfield alongside Pierre-Emile Hojbjerg. His consistency will be a key asset for Conte as he could look to count on the player in the future.

Spurs were held to a 0-0 draw by Rafael Benitez’s side, and they remain in the ninth position in the league. Having 16 points from the 11 matches, they are well behind the top four places and will need to rally in the upcoming games.

The substitution of Giovani Lo Celso at the end helped to switch gears as Tottenham struggled for creativity throughout the game. He nearly gave his team the three points after a brilliant play saw his shot hit the post.

The Spurs manager will have something to think about in the international break to find the right balance between creativity and solidity. The Skipp and Hojbjerg midfield duo offer security and progression but, they still have issues in the final third, as was the case throughout this season.

Whether the yougnster will go on to reinvent himself under Conte or take his performance to a higher level remains to be seen.
